Program Description

The University of Manchester’s BSc Management (Accounting and Finance) delivers a versatile management foundation before specialising in accounting and finance from year two, with the option of a paid industrial placement to build real-world experience. Built on strong professional accreditation and employer demand, graduates secure roles in audit, analysis, and finance or pursue further study, benefiting from Manchester’s powerful career support and industry connections. Ranked among the top UK schools for Accounting & Finance and widely targeted by leading employers, it sets a high-achievement trajectory.
